CNN Announces Layoffs as Network Looks to Cut Costs
Prominent news network CNN (Left Bias) announced a round of layoffs this week as the media company seeks to cut costs.
For Context: CNN’s parent company, Warner Bros., merged with Discovery in May. Chris Licht was brought in as CEO of CNN around the same time. In October, Licht hinted that layouts were imminent, citing “concern over the global economic outlook.”

As College Costs Rise, Gen Z Shifts Toward Skilled Trades
Younger people are increasingly passing up a four-year college education to pursue skilled trades.
